R142 FAV is a 1998 Ford Galaxy in Blue with a 2,306c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.

Across all 1998 Ford Galaxy models, the average MOT pass rate is 64.4% with a typical mileage of 113,496 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Ford Galaxy f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 102,272 recorded failures. If you're considering buying R142 FAV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ford Galaxy typ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 28 years old, this Ford Galaxy is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
